VidWare Vision™ Modular Versatile Primitives
are proprietary algorithms, methods, techniques, and
processes that are unique to VidWare, and target
performance, quality, reliability, and flexibility.
The main primitives consist of:
|
POS |
Processor
Optimized Streams
Video streams and file I/O are highly optimized by
reading and writing in bit quantities that are
directly suited to processor memory and register
configurations rather that using the traditional
bit-by-bit methodology. This also allows direct
manipulation of data rather than having to reformat
for processing.

E4 |
Energy-Efficient Entropy Encoding
This
technology significantly improves VidWare H.264
encoder efficiency by quickly and accurately
determining the best possible macro block
compression mode, thus yielding the highest-quality
image possible within in the smallest possible
bandwidth. The determination process is made
computationally efficient by only encoding the best
possible mode.
|
|
FQAM |
Flexible Quality Aware
Modules
Because the CODEC has been developed from the ground
up and not based on the JVT reference code, the
software has been designed in a modular and flexible
way. All critical modules have input, process, and
output test points and are self monitoring for
accuracy and conformance without adding to
processing power requirements. The modular design
allows for customization and future enhancements to
be performed very quickly.
